A statistical shape model of the left ventricle from real-time 3D echocardiography and its application to myocardial segmentation of cardiac magnetic resonance images. |
Abstract | ||
---|---|---|
•A multi-modal statistical shape modeling algorithm is applied on cardiac imaging.•A 3D model of the left ventricle is built from real-time 3D echocardiography.•The model is adopted to segment the left ventricle in cardiac MR images.•The same model is adopted for 3D endocardium and epicardium segmentation.•A patient-specific 3D model of the left ventricle can be obtained from cardiac MR. |
